u/Biff_Tannenator 11d ago
This is super cool.
It got me thinking of possible improvements. What if you place mirrors at different depths between the pillars, so that the patters repeat at different intervals? So like, if the main center mirror is 3 inches back, the mirror on the left side would be 2.6 inches back. and then the part on the right could contain a "pepper's ghost" mirror that's at a 45 degree angle. Not sure if that last part would work, but if it did, it might sell the illusion more.

u/Void_In_The_Walls 11d ago
Nice work! If you use a front surface mirror, you can get rid of that visually disruptive mirror gap. You may need to enclose the space though, since those mirrors are more fragile.
